Using a highly personalized language of characters, faces, creatures and messages and often rendering her large-scale black and white drawings live in front of an audience, Martin invites viewers to actively engage in her creative process. Using drawing as a physical stream-of-consciousness, her work is characterized by a unique freedom, expressed through the possibilities of her chosen canvas--whether that be a piece of paper or a textile, a sculptural surface, a wall or a screen. \u003c\/p\u003e\u003cp\u003e\u003c\/p\u003eBridging the fine art and commercial worlds since her beginnings making live performance drawings in the mega clubs of Tokyo, Martin navigates different creative worlds to interrogate and play with the roles of artist and viewer in a uniquely charming, accessible style. \u003cp\u003e\u003c\/p\u003eThis monograph charts, for the first time, the career of this prolific and popular artist, including early pieces such as \"Dear Grandmother\" (a 2003 collaboration between the artist and her grandmother on over 70 pieces of embroidery), large-scale murals and commissions and collaborations with museums, technical institutes, musicians and fashion brands. \u003cp\u003e\u003c\/p\u003eLondon-born, New York-based artist \u003cb\u003eShantell Martin\u003c\/b\u003e (born 1980) is best known for her signature black-and-white drawings. She has had solo shows at 92Y Gallery and the Museum of Contemporary African Diasporan Arts, New York.
